US suspends stipends paid to Palestinians families

WASHINGTON:The United States has suspended stipends paid to families of Palestinians killed or jailed in fighting with Israel.

The Taylor Force Act, named after an American killed in Israel by a Palestinian in 2016, was folded into a 1.3 trillion dollars spending bill signed by President Donald Trump.

Palestinian official Nabil Abu Rdeneh condemned the law, saying it doesn't allow for the creation of an atmosphere conducive to peace. (AP)
